Walking The Thames Day 14

7.3 mi Marlow to Hurley

I guess this is getting routine. A pretty short walking day so David can do a 4-hour training run. A bunch of flooding just outside Marlow so we had a great detour that some locals directed us to. The river and water table are high, but everyone was out enjoying this partially cloudy & rainless Saturday. The English just slosh through the puddles in their "wellies". (Wellington boots).
My Hoka One One tennis shoes with waterproof socks have been great but proper waterproof boots might have been a better choice.

Staying in an English Pub with rooms. Proprietor is Canadian so she said they have oatmeal for breakfast. I had some tea while David does his long run.
